"The secret of a man who is universally interesting is that he is universally interested." - William Dean Howells, American author (1837-1920).

Homo sum, humani a me nihil alienum puto'
Man I am, humanity to me not alien think.  Rhb transliteration
I am a person, therefore all that concern people is of interest to me.  Rhb paraphrase

First seek to understand, then seek to be understood.  Steven Covey
First seek to be interested, then seek to be interesting. Rhb

The secret to being a great date is to be interested in your date.  Paraphrase of Albert Ellis in Sex and the Single Man

Curiosity killed the cat, satisfaction brought him back. Unknown
